Explain the operation of IRET instruction. What memory locations contain the vector for an INT 34 instruction?
The Interrupt return (IRET) instruction is utilized only along with software or hardware interrupt service procedures. When an IRET instruction executes, this stores the contents of I and T from the stack. It is important since it preserves the state of the flag bits. If interrupts were enabled before an interrupt service process, they automatically re-enabled through the IRET instruction since this restores the flag register.
Interrupt no. 20-FF are stored at an address 80 - 3FFH.
